Mitsubishi Motors Corporation is usually a multinational automotive manufacturer headquartered in Minato, Tokyo, Japan. In 2011, Mitsubishi Motors was the sixth biggest Japanese automaker plus the sixteenth biggest worldwide by simply production. From October 2016 onwards, Mitsubishi is majority-owned simply by Nissan, and thus a perhaps the Renault-Nissan Alliance.Besides being part in the Renault-Nissan Alliance, it is also a part of Mitsubishi keiretsu, formerly the biggest commercial group in Japan, through the corporation's minority 20% stake in Mitsubishi Generators, and the company has been originally formed in 1970 in the automotive division of Mitsubishi Heavy Industries.Mitsubishi Fuso Truck as well as Bus Corporation was formerly a component of Mitsubishi Motors, but is now independent from Mitsubishi Motors, which builds commercial rank trucks, buses and heavy construction equipment, and is owned simply by Daimler AG.
Mitsubishi's automotive origins date time for 1917, when the Mitsubishi Shipbuilding Co., Ltd. introduced the Mitsubishi Design A, Japan's first series-production auto. An entirely hand-built seven-seater sedan using the Fiat Tipo 3, it proved expensive in comparison to its American and American mass-produced rivals, and was discontinued throughout 1921 after only 22 have been built.In 1934, Mitsubishi Shipbuilding was merged using the Mitsubishi Aircraft Co., a company established within 1920 to manufacture aircraft engines as well as other parts. The unified company was often known as Mitsubishi Heavy Industries (MHI), and was the biggest private company in Asia. MHI concentrated on making aircraft, ships, railroad cars and equipment, but in 1937 designed the PX33, a prototype sedan intended for military use. It was the primary Japanese-built passenger car along with full-time four-wheel drive, a technology the company would resume almost fifty years later in its quest for motorsport and sales achievement.

Rigtht after the end of the next World War, the company returned in order to manufacturing vehicles. Fuso bus production resumed, while a small three-wheeled cargo vehicle called the Mizushima as well as a scooter called the Silver Pigeon were also produced. However, the zaibatsu (Japan's family-controlled professional conglomerates) were ordered being dismantled by the Allied forces in 1950, and Mitsubishi Heavy Industries was put into three regional companies, each with an involvement in motor vehicle development: West Japan Heavy-Industries, Central Japan Heavy-Industries, and East Japan Heavy-Industries.East Japan Heavy-Industries begun importing the Henry N, an inexpensive American sedan built by Kaiser Magnetic motors, in knockdown kit (CKD) type in 1951, and continued to bring these phones Japan for the remainder in the car's three-year production operate. The same year, Central Japan Heavy-Industries concluded a comparable contract with Willys (today owned by Kaiser) pertaining to CKD-assembled Jeep CJ-3Bs. This deal proved more durable, with licensed Mitsubishi Jeeps throughout production until 1998, thirty years after Willys independently had replaced the model.

By the beginning of the 1960s Japan's economy was gearing up; wages were rising and the thinking behind family motoring was removing. Central Japan Heavy-Industries, now known as Tibia Mitsubishi Heavy-Industries, had already re-established a good automotive department in its headquarters in 1953. Now it was willing to introduce the Mitsubishi 500, a mass market sedan, to meet the brand-new demand from consumers. It followed this in 1962 while using the Minica kei car as well as the Colt 1000, the first of its Colt type of family cars, in 1963. In 1964, Mitsubishi introduced its most significant passenger sedan, the Mitsubishi Debonair as being a luxury car primarily with the Japanese market, and was used simply by senior Mitsubishi executives like a company car.West Japan Heavy-Industries (right now renamed Mitsubishi Shipbuilding & Anatomist) and East Okazaki, japan Heavy-Industries (now Mitsubishi Nihon Heavy-Industries) experienced also expanded their automotive departments inside 1950s, and the three have been re-integrated as Mitsubishi Heavy Industries in 1964. Within three years their output was over 75, 000 vehicles annually. Following the successful introduction on the first Galant in 1969 and similar growth featuring a commercial vehicle division, it was decided how the company should create a single operation to spotlight the automotive industry. Mitsubishi Motors Corporation (MMC) seemed to be formed on April 25, 1970 as a wholly owned subsidiary of MHI beneath leadership of Tomio Kubo, a successful engineer through the aircraft division. The logo of three crimson diamonds, shared with over forty others within the keiretsu, predates Mitsubishi Motors itself by almost a hundred years. It was chosen by Iwasaki Yatarō, the founder of Mitsubishi, as it was suggestive with the emblem of the Tosa Clan who first employed him or her, and because his individual family crest was 3 rhombuses stacked atop 1 another. The name Mitsubishi is really a compound of mitsu ("three") and also hishi (literally, "water chestnut", often used in Japoneses to denote a diamond or rhombus).
